Background technology
In various examination occasion, always have omnifarious fraudulent means, invigilator person and cribber are always in continuation " game of cat and mousecat-and-mouse ".In order to tackle cribber, various invigilator's means also emerge in an endless stream.Such as electronic signal shielding device, handle type metal detector, electronic monitoring video recording system etc. are equipped with to whole examination hall, but these systems seem flawless, actually there is many drawbacks.
1, monitoring effect is poor in real time.The course of work of electronic monitoring video recording system is called at camera networking in all examination halls, to examination hall Real-time Collection video information, concentrates and be placed on a watch-dog, the pivoted inquiry of multiwindow.Which is equivalent to a people and monitors multiple examination hall, in the process when the personnel of invigilator pay close attention to wherein a certain examination hall time, need camera be adjusted near, amplify monitored picture, at this moment the real-time condition in other examination halls just cannot be paid close attention to, and then can miss many transient cheating scenes.Even if there is video recording to inquire about afterwards, but need a large amount of manpowers and time just can complete, do not have which test tissue unit to be ready to wait after seal type examination paper sealing again to undisciplined examinee " square of accounts after the autumn harvest ".
2, preventing function is single.Handle type metal detector, is applied to the safety check at airport, subway entrance place at first.Because the gimmick cheated with communication tools more in recent years gets more and more, just used gradually.Although detector functions is powerful, it is not omnipotent, and it has just limitedly been stopped some metal cheating tools and has infiltrated examination hall, and for nonmetallic cheating tool, it is had no way out again.And to some important examination such as civil servant examinations, college entrance examination and in examine, adopt these equipments to give no cause for much criticism, if but the interim pre-test pilot production of school inside is equipped with these, " gone to war " with regard to some.
3, affect people life and may threat be there is to examinee's physical and mental health.The such as use of electronic signal shielding device, it can bring interference to the normal life of the examination hall periphery masses, causes mobile phone or TV, broadcast receiver etc. normally to use.The examinee be in examination hall is subject to the interference of intense electromagnetic ripple, may cause uncomfortable, affects the normal performance of examinee.

Embodiment
See Fig. 1, the utility model provides a kind of invigilator's system that can monitor in real time, this invigilator's system that can monitor in real time is all made up of hardware, identical with conditional electronic supervisory video recording system is, include the examination hall supervisory control system (mainly contain camera composition) that is arranged on inside, examination hall and be arranged on master-control room supervisory control system that is outside examination hall and that be connected with examination hall supervisory control system, master-control room supervisory control system comprises monitor, server and main controller; Monitor and main controller are connected with server respectively, and network in charge gathers video information, compression process video information, store video information and transmission of video information; Main controller is responsible for the overall management of invigilator's system, the transferring of the inquiry of real-time video information and video information; The display of video information is responsible for by monitor, can according to the quantity of examination hall quantity determination monitor.The master-control room supervisory control system course of work is, first catch video information by camera, enter server, in the server by video frequency collection card process video information, information after process is directly transferred to monitor by server on the one hand, examination hall supervisory control system is transferred on the one hand by server, on the other hand at server internal by video compression card process, again compressed file is automatically stored in server, when main controller sends playback application, compressed file is transferred in monitor in order to inspection by server again.
Please continue see Fig. 1 that (arrow in Fig. 1 represents information transfer directions, and solid arrow refers to wired connection, and dotted arrow refers to wireless connections; In figure, examination hall supervisory control system only represents a certain examination hall, other examination hall supervisory control systems are identical therewith, each examination hall four data lines are connected to server), the utility model and traditional electronic monitoring video recording system unlike: the supervisory control system being arranged on inside, examination hall changed, this examination hall supervisory control system comprises the first camera, second camera, the first radio-frequency (RF) transceiver, the second radio-frequency (RF) transceiver, first invigilator's device and second invigilator's device; Server accesses the first camera and second camera respectively by the first radio-frequency (RF) transceiver and the second radio-frequency (RF) transceiver; First camera and second camera access server respectively; First invigilator's device and second invigilator's device access the first radio-frequency (RF) transceiver and the second radio-frequency (RF) transceiver respectively; First invigilator's device and second is invigilated device and is connected.Wherein, camera respectively joins 1 before and after examination hall, and primary responsibility catches video information, can adopt high definition rotatable camera; The video information that invigilator's device charge of overseeing and playback camera catch in real time, regulation and control camera running status, autonomous capture the on-the-spot evidence of cheating and and other invigilate between device and carry out information transmission; Device, signal transmission between server and camera are responsible for and are invigilated to radio-frequency (RF) transceiver.
Traditional selective monitoring in master-control room is changed into the inner monitoring in real time in examination hall by the utility model, and its monitoring range is wide, guarantees monitoring effect.
As preferred implementation of the present utility model, the utility model also improves invigilator's device: see Fig. 2, and first invigilator's device and second invigilator's device include data processing chip, invigilator's device radio-frequency (RF) transceiver, video frequency collection card, display screen, input keyboard and communication earphone; Invigilator's device radio-frequency (RF) transceiver, video frequency collection card, display screen and input keyboard are connected with data processing chip respectively; Invigilator's device radio-frequency (RF) transceiver is connected with communication earphone; Invigilator's device radio-frequency (RF) transceiver of first invigilator's device and invigilator's device radio-frequency (RF) transceiver of second invigilator's device are connected with the first radio-frequency (RF) transceiver and the second radio-frequency (RF) transceiver respectively; First invigilator's device and second invigilator's device also include the memory be connected with data processing chip.
The utility model is when specifically using, first the information transmitted from master-control room supervisory control system be transported to respectively in first invigilator's device, second invigilator's device by the first radio-frequency (RF) transceiver, the second radio-frequency (RF) transceiver and show, in order to examination hall, invigilator personnel monitor in real time.If invigilator person thinks playback section video, so just send playback instruction (being realized by input keyboard and touch screen) by first invigilator's device or second invigilator's device, after first radio-frequency (RF) transceiver or the second radio-frequency (RF) transceiver receive instruction, be transferred to server, the video information required for server sends according to command request; If invigilator person wants to be undertaken capturing or making a video recording by camera locking cheating target, so just send instruction by first invigilator's device or second invigilator's device, after first radio-frequency (RF) transceiver or the second radio-frequency (RF) transceiver receive instruction, be transferred to the first camera or second camera controlling organization, this mechanism controls camera running status according to command request, video information is sent to server process by camera, and the information back after process shows to invigilator's device by server more in real time.Between invigilator person during mutual transmission information, send instruction by wherein invigilator's device, directly can be received by another invigilator's device, after instruction is processed, make response rapidly.Invigilator's device can independently be captured according to actual needs or make a video recording.
